Slide 26 Video Tips & Tricks Dont use monitor as light source Desk lamp as light source Soft background lighting Bounce lamp light off wall Decrease monitor brightness. Clean background White shirt How to Improve Your Cheapo Webcams Picture Quality www.bit.ly/cleanwebcam Slide 27 Sending a Chat Slide 28 Sending Private Chat Slide 29 Private Chat tabs Slide 30 Collaboration Tool Bar Slide 31 Load Content to Whiteboard Guidelines Limits: 2 MB per file, 10 MB total per session Slideshow Filetypes:.wbd.wbp.ppt.pptx.sxi.odp Image Filetypes:.bmp.gif.jpg.jpeg.png Only Moderators can Load Content All other filetypes will be loaded into the File Transfer Library Be sure that Powerpoint is not running!
